Bug ID: 69665 Summary: Internal error on #pragma push_macro("__FILE__") Product: gcc Version: 5.3.0 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: P3 Component: preprocessor Assignee: unassigned at gcc dot gnu.org Reporter: Keith.S.Thompson at gmail dot com Target Milestone: --- The line of code that causes the problem is from this answer on Stack Overflow, posted by Alain Totouom: http://stackoverflow.com/a/30799998/827263 The main problem, of course, is that cpp dies with an internal error. A minor secondary problem is that after reporting the internal error, cpp prints a tab character to stdout, not followed by a newline.
